八年级上册信息技术第一课《用 Python 编程》教案.docx

八年级上册信息技术第一课《用 Python 编程》教案.docx

  1. 1、本文档共7页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

八年级上册信息技术第一课《用Python编程》教案

主备人

备课成员

教学内容

本节课是八年级上册信息技术课程的第一课,课程标题为《用Python编程》。本节课的教学内容主要包括以下几个部分:

1.Python编程环境搭建:让学生了解并掌握Python编程环境的基本使用方法,包括安装Python、配置开发环境等。

2.Python语法基础:介绍Python编程语言的基本语法,如变量、数据类型、运算符、条件语句和循环语句等。

3.编程实践:通过编写简单的Python程序,让学生掌握基本的编程技巧,如输入输出、控制流程等。

4.算法与逻辑:引导学生理解算法和逻辑的重要性,并通过编写程序来锻炼学生的逻辑思维能力。

5.课程总结与拓展:对本节课所学内容进行总结,并提出一些拓展任务,激发学生对Python编程的兴趣和深入学习的态度。

本节课旨在让学生初步了解Python编程语言,掌握基本语法和编程技巧,培养学生的逻辑思维能力,并为后续课程打下基础。

核心素养目标分析

本节课的核心素养目标主要包括以下几个方面:

1.信息技术素养:培养学生对Python编程语言的兴趣和好奇心,提高学生运用信息技术解决问题的能力。

2.逻辑思维:通过学习Python语法和编程实践,锻炼学生的逻辑思维能力,培养分析问题和解决问题的习惯。

3.创新与实践:鼓励学生进行编程实践,培养学生的创新精神和实践能力,让学生在编程过程中体验到成就感。

4.团队合作:在课程实践环节,鼓励学生进行合作交流,培养学生的团队合作意识和沟通能力。

5.信息伦理与道德:引导学生树立正确的信息伦理观念,养成良好的网络行为习惯,遵守法律法规,保护个人和他人隐私。

学习者分析

1.学生已经掌握的相关知识:学生在之前的课程中可能已经学习了计算机的基本操作、网络基础等信息技术知识。对于部分学生,他们可能已经接触过编程,例如Scratch或Python的初级应用。

2.学生的学习兴趣、能力和学习风格:八年级的学生对新鲜事物充满好奇,具有一定的探索精神。他们在学习过程中,更倾向于通过实践来掌握知识。在学习能力方面,学生们具备一定的逻辑思维和问题解决能力。在学习风格上,他们喜欢互动和合作学习,希望能够得到及时的反馈和鼓励。

3.学生可能遇到的困难和挑战:在学习Python编程过程中,学生可能会遇到以下困难和挑战:

(1)编程环境搭建:部分学生可能会遇到安装Python和配置开发环境时的技术问题。

(2)语法理解:Python语法对于初学者来说可能较为复杂,学生需要在课堂上逐步消化和理解。

(3)编程实践:在编写程序时,学生可能会遇到逻辑错误和语法错误,需要教师耐心引导和解答。

(4)算法与逻辑思维:培养学生解决问题的能力和逻辑思维是本节课的重点,学生需要通过大量的练习来提高。

教师应根据学生的实际情况,调整教学策略,注重个体差异,鼓励学生的自主学习和合作学习,帮助学生克服困难,提高他们的编程能力和逻辑思维能力。

学具准备

多媒体

课型

新授课

教法学法

讲授法

课时

第一课时

步骤

师生互动设计

二次备课

教学方法与策略

1.教学方法:本节课将采用讲授法、实践法和互动式教学法。讲授法用于介绍Python编程环境搭建和语法基础,实践法用于编程实践和算法训练,互动式教学法用于课堂讨论和问题解答。

2.教学活动设计:

(1)课堂导入:通过一个简单的Python程序示例,激发学生的兴趣和好奇心。

(2)编程实践:分组进行编程任务,鼓励学生互相讨论和合作,培养团队合作意识。

(3)算法与逻辑思维训练:设计一些有趣的编程题目,引导学生运用所学的语法和逻辑知识解决问题。

3.教学媒体使用:

(1)使用多媒体教学设备展示Python编程环境搭建和语法基础的讲解内容。

(2)在编程实践环节,使用投影仪显示学生编写的程序和运行结果,方便学生观察和讨论。

(3)利用网络资源,为学生提供一些拓展阅读和实践案例,帮助他们巩固所学知识。

教学实施过程

1.课前自主探索

教师活动:

-发布预习任务:通过在线平台或班级微信群,发布预习资料(如PPT、视频、文档等),明确预习目标和要求。

-设计预习问题:围绕Python编程环境搭建,设计一系列具有启发性和探究性的问题,引导学生自主思考。

-监控预习进度:利用平台功能或学生反馈,监控学生的预习进度,确保预习效果。

学生活动:

-自主阅读预习资料:按照预习要求,自主阅读预习资料,理解Python编程环境搭建的知识点。

-思考预习问题:针对预习问题,进行独立思考,记录自己的理解和疑问。

-提交预习成果:将预习成果(如笔记、思维导

文档评论(0)

177****7752 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档